  • I bought this fixed gear road machine here recently and have been making a few modifications to it in order to run it on the street. Here's where I'm at with the setup.
    -2017 Fuji Track PRO USA Complete Bicycle
    -50/14 Gearing Fixed
    -Zipp SL 70 Aero Cabon Drop Bars
    -Quarq DZero 170 Aluminum 110 NHB GXP Crank based Power meter
    -BDop 110BCD to 144BCD Track Adaptor
    -Speedplay Stainless Steel Zero Pedals
